The Science of Cold Water Immersion
Cold water immersion is the practice of submerging the body in cold water, typically around 11°C, for a set duration. In the study involving twelve semi-professional soccer players, participants underwent a series of recovery methods after completing a demanding exercise test. They experienced CWI, a placebo intervention, and passive recovery over three weeks.
The results were telling. Cold water immersion and the placebo intervention both outperformed passive recovery in key areas, such as muscle soreness and physical performance. Specifically, participants reported less delayed onset muscle soreness (DOMS) and maintained better performance levels in physical tests after CWI compared to resting alone. The study highlighted that CWI significantly reduced muscle soreness and improved physical performance metrics, such as squat jumps and sprints, 24 and 48 hours post-exercise.
Understanding the Placebo Effect
While the physical benefits of CWI are clear, the research also uncovered an interesting insight: part of its effectiveness may be attributed to the placebo effect. This phenomenon suggests that our beliefs and expectations regarding a treatment can significantly influence its outcomes.
In this study, participants who believed they were benefiting from the recovery methods—whether through CWI or a placebo drink—experienced enhanced recovery. Practical Applications for Your Recovery Ritual
Incorporating CWI into your post-exercise routine can enhance recovery and maintain high performance levels. Here are some actionable steps to consider:
Protocol Design: After high-intensity workouts or matches, aim for a 15-minute cold water immersion at temperatures around 11°C. This duration has shown significant benefits in muscle recovery.
